ABOUT SAMB

Established in July 2012, following the merger between The South African Ballet Theatre (SABT) and Mzansi Productions, South African Mzansi Ballet (SAMB) is Joburg’s very own professional ballet company – a first world ballet company for a first world city.

SAMB is proudly resident at the Joburg Theatre. The company consists of permanent and ad-hoc dancers skilled in both classical ballet and contemporary dance.

An extensive repertoire includes works by Petipa, Ivanov, Bovim, Maqoma, Paeper, Balanchine, Saint-Léon, Wubbe as well as home-grown choreographers Kitty Phetla, Iain MacDonald and Shannon Glover. An active performance schedule is maintained with two major seasons at the Joburg Theatre as well as promotional events, corporate entertainment, local and international tours.

In addition to the professional company, and under the auspices of SAMB, the following programmes are managed:

  • Development School in Alexandra, Olifantsfontein, Tshwane, Sophiatown, Mamelodi, Eesterus, Katlehong, Melville, Soweto and Braamfontein
  • A newly established South African Cuban School
  • An extra-curricular Ballet Academy for high school students and
  • A Graduate (apprenticeship) Programme
